Young man caught hiding in bank ceiling after failed overnight heist

An unusual security breach reportedly took place at the FCMB Secretariat, according to a post making the rounds on social media.

Eyewitness accounts say the incident began when a man walked into the premises pretending to be a customer. He went straight to the restroom, locked himself in, and somehow made his way to the ceiling.

Later that evening, after staff had closed for the day and left the building, the man is said to have come down from the ceiling and attempted to access the office’s systems. He then locked himself inside the office. When employees returned the next morning, they found the office door locked from the inside. After breaking it open, they discovered the man still hiding in the ceiling. As they turned on the systems, a strange message appeared on the screen: “Restarting, click OK to accept.”

Authorities are yet to confirm the man’s identity or what his intentions were. The suspect was eventually taken down by security operatives, who found him attempting to tamper with the bank’s system. As of press time, the bank has yet to issue an official statement on the incident.
